"Cory"
 

Cory “Curby” Dickens received his first tattoo at 28 and while he was getting worked on, he was immediately taken by the art form.  During the small talk with the artist, he found out what he was going to need to do to get an apprenticeship and learn the art.  In 2004, Cory moved from the small town he was living in to Portland Oregon and began his apprenticeship at Captain Jack’s Tattoo, leaving his wife behind.  After spending a year there, he moved back to Klamath Falls and began working at Steel Sensation Body Modifications.  He worked there for two years before coming to the conclusion that he had progressed as far as he could as an artist, so he and his wife decided it was time to leave.  Since his wife, Brenda, had family in Florida they ended up moving across country to the Sunshine State.  Shortly after arriving, Cory began looking for work along the Treasure Coast and was lucky enough to get picked up by South Florida Tattoo.
